- the invention relates to a tissue punch, and more particularly, the invention relates to a tissue punch for forming an opening in a target blood vessel for deploying an anastomosis device to connect a graft vessel to the target blood vessel.
- Vascular anastomosis is a procedure by which two blood vessels within a patient are surgically joined together. Vascular anastomosis is performed during treatment of a variety of conditions including coronary artery disease, diseases of the great and peripheral vessels, organ transplantation, and trauma.
- coronary artery disease CAD
- an occlusion or stenosis in a coronary artery interferes with blood flow to the heart muscle.
- Treatment of CAD involves the grafting of a vessel in the form of a prosthesis or harvested artery or vein to reroute blood flow around the occlusion and restore adequate blood flow to the heart muscle. This treatment is known as coronary artery bypass grafting (CABG).
- CABG coronary artery bypass grafting
- vascular anastomosis device which easily connects a graft vessel to a target vessel and can be deployed in limited space.
- a sutureless anastomosis device such as those described in U.S. Patent Application Serial No. 09/314,278, involves forming an opening in the target vessel and inserting the anastomosis device with a graft vessel attached into the opening. Accordingly, it would be desirable to provide a one piece tool which can perform both tissue punching and anastomosis device deployment. In order to provide a one piece device it would be desirable to provide a tissue punch which is advanced through a trocar and then is moved out of the trocar to allow deployment of the anastomosis device through the same trocar.
- the present invention relates to a tissue punch for forming an opening in a target blood vessel for deploying an anastomosis device to connect a graft vessel to the target vessel.
- an apparatus for piercing a vessel, punching a hole in the vessel, removing punched tissue from the vessel, and introducing an object into the vessel through the punched hole is described.
- the apparatus includes a punch with a pointed piercing end for piercing a vessel to allow introduction of the punch into the vessel, a tubular element arranged coaxially with the punch through which the punch retracts to remove vessel tissue, and an introducer located coaxially around the tubular element.
- a tissue punch includes a piercing element, a cutting edge, and a trocar receiving the piercing element.
- the piercing element has a pointed distal end, a tissue receiving space, and an anvil adjacent the tissue receiving space.
- the cutting edge is arranged to contact the anvil to cut a piece of tissue.
- the trocar has a side opening for removing the piercing element from the trocar after punching tissue.
- a method of punching a plug of tissue from the wall of a blood vessel includes the steps of penetrating the wall of the blood vessel with a piercing element to form an opening in the blood vessel, punching a plug of tissue around the opening in the blood vessel, and inserting a trocar into the punched hole in the blood vessel.
- a double tissue punch includes a piercing element having a pointed distal end and a first anvil surface; a first cutting element movable with respect to the piercing element, the first cutting element having a cutting edge arranged to contact the first anvil surface; and the first cutting element having a second anvil surface, a second cutting element movable with respect to the piercing element and the first cutting element, the second cutting element having a cutting edge arranged to contact the second anvil surface.
- the present invention provides advantages of a tissue punch which is deployed through a trocar and is removed through a side wall of the trocar so that the trocar can subsequently be used for deployment of a medical device.
- the invention also provides the advantage of trapping a tissue plug which is cut by the tissue punch.

- the tissue punch according to the present invention is used to create a hole in a wall of a target blood vessel for receiving an anastomosis device to connect a graft vessel to the target vessel.
- the tissue punch includes a piercing element for penetrating the target vessel wall, a cutter for cutting a plug of tissue, and a trocar which is inserted in the opening in the wall after punching has been completed. After punching is complete, the piercing element is removed from the trocar and the anastomosis device is then deployed through the open lumen of the trocar.
- the tissue punch according to the present invention is particularly useful for use in coronary artery bypass grafting (CABG) in which a graft vessel is connected at opposite ends to the aorta and to a coronary artery.
- CABG coronary artery bypass grafting
- the target vessel which is punched with the tissue punch can be any vessel including but not limited to the aorta, coronary artery, and arteries leading to the arms or head.
- the graft vessel for connection to the target vessel can be an arterial graft, a venous graft, or a synthetic prosthesis, as required.
- the anastomosis procedure is preferably performed with minimally invasive procedures, without the stoppage of blood flow in the target vessel, and without the use of cardiopulmonary bypass.
- the anastomosis procedure may also be performed as a stopped heart and/or open chest procedure.
- the tissue punches according to the present invention are incorporated in a one piece tool which performs tissue punching and deployment of the anastomosis device.
- This one piece tool may be operated manually, such as by cams, or automatically, such as pneumatically.
- FIG. 1 is a perspective view of a tissue punch 10 according to the invention which includes a one-piece piercing element 14 positioned within an introducer sheath or trocar 16.
- the piercing element 14 can be advanced and retracted in the trocar 16 by an elongated member 18 such as a spring steel strap or cable which extends through an opening 20 in a side of the trocar.
- the piercing element 14 includes a pointed distal tip 22 for penetrating the target vessel wall and a narrow shaft portion 28 around which the tissue of the target vessel wall contracts after piercing.
- the distal tip 12 may be formed, for example, as a conical surface or by a plurality of ground surfaces extending to a point at the distal tip.
- An anvil surface 24 is located on the piercing element 14 between the distal tip 22 and the shaft 28. The anvil surface 24 acts with a cutting edge 26 of the trocar 16 to cut an annular plug of tissue.
- the piercing element 14 is forcibly advanced to puncture the target vessel wall. After piercing, the tissue of the target vessel wall rests around the shaft portion 28 of the piercing element 14. The piercing element 14 is then pulled back inside the trocar 16 by the elongated member 18 to cut an annular plug of tissue by compressing the tissue between the anvil surface 24 of the piercing element and the cutting edge 26 of the trocar 16. The cut plug of tissue can be trapped in an annular space surrounding the shaft 28 and removed from the surgical site on the piercing element 14. By using the tissue punch 10 to cut a plug of the target vessel wall tissue in this manner, there is less tendency for tearing.

- FIG. 6-24 illustrate alternative embodiments of tissue punches including tissue traps for trapping and retaining the plug of tissue which is cut by the tissue punch.
- the trapping of tissue plug prevents possible complications which could occur if the plug of tissue is released in the surgical site.

- 25-30 illustrate a sequence of tissue punching with a double punch system for forming an opening in the wall of a blood vessel.
- the double punch system 150 is used to make openings larger than those made by a single punch embodiment. For openings larger than about 3 mm a double punch is preferred since a piercing element with a largest diameter of greater than about 3 mm tends to cause excessive trauma to the tissue.
- the double punch system 150 includes a piercing element 154 having a first anvil 156, a spreading element 158 having a second anvil 160 and a first cutter 162, and a sleeve 164 having a second cutter 166.
- the piercing element 154 is first inserted through the tissue 170 of a blood vessel wall until the tissue rests around a shaft 172 of the piercing element.
- the spreading element 158 is then moved downwards as shown in FIG. 27 to cut a first plug of tissue 174 with the first cutter 162.
- the first plug 174 is contained within an interior of the spreading element 158 which forms a tissue trap.

- FIG. 30 illustrates the withdrawal of the double punch system 150 containing the two annular plugs 174, 180 of tissue and leaving a tissue opening 184.
- the double punch system is illustrated as a system for forming holes which are larger than an approximately 3 mm hole which can be easily formed with a single punch system.
- the double punch system can form holes of up to about 8 mm in diameter without causing tissue trauma. In order to make holes of larger diameters additional spreading elements and cutting elements can be used to form a triple punch system or other multiple punch system.
